Decathlon

Decathlon is among the largest retailers of sporting goods in the world. It oversees all aspects of research, design, production and logistics in-house, partners with suppliers from around the world and sells directly to consumers through big-box Decathlon stores. This vertical integration lets Decathlon eliminate middlemen and keep costs low. Decathlon has a specific brand for each sport. For instance Nabaji is a swimming brand, Quechua is for hiking/trekking and Kalenji is a running brand. Wedze is for downhill skiing. Oroks, for ice hockey.

The low cost of sports opens the sport to more people, but they don't cut corners on performance or quality. Instead, they improve the quality of products through innovation and technology. Cos

Cos is H&M's premium brand. It is part of a group that includes & Other Stories (and other stories), Arket, Cheap Sunday, and Monki. It was introduced in 2007 and currently has 264 stores across the world. It also sells on the internet.

COS is renowned for its simple, timeless designs. Its dedication to providing top-quality customer service encourages trust and loyalty from its customers. The employees of the company are welcoming and knowledgeable, helping customers find the perfect size.

They offer a variety of options such as cashmere and merino Wool, which are all RWS-certified, unmulesed. They also offer a variety of organic cotton tops that have elegantly designed designs. These styles can be worn on their own or layered. These clothes are machine washable. COS is also making positive progress on its sustainability goal for 2025 as per the ethical rating app Good On You. They recently introduced transparent sustainability information at a product level, which is higher than most high-street brands do.
